博客 数据分析实战:高效特征工程与模型调优技巧

数据分析实战:高效特征工程与模型调优技巧

   数栈君   发表于 2025-10-14 18:50  66  0

在数据分析领域,特征工程和模型调优是两个至关重要的环节。无论是数据中台的构建、数字孪生的应用,还是数字可视化的实现,特征工程和模型调优都扮演着核心角色。本文将深入探讨这两个环节的关键技巧,帮助企业用户提升数据分析的效率和效果。


一、特征工程的重要性

特征工程是数据分析过程中将原始数据转化为模型可用特征的关键步骤。高质量的特征能够显著提升模型的性能,而低质量或不相关的特征则可能导致模型效果不佳。以下是特征工程的几个关键点:

1. 数据清洗与预处理

  • 缺失值处理:缺失值是数据分析中常见的问题。可以通过均值、中位数或特定算法(如KNN)进行填充。
  • 异常值处理:异常值可能对模型产生负面影响,可以通过统计方法(如Z-score)或机器学习方法(如Isolation Forest)进行检测和处理。
  • 数据标准化/归一化:对于不同量纲的特征,需要进行标准化(如Z-score)或归一化(如Min-Max)处理,以确保模型训练的稳定性。

2. 特征提取与构造

  • 特征提取:从高维数据中提取关键特征,例如使用PCA(主成分分析)或LDA(线性判别分析)。
  • 特征构造:根据业务需求构造新特征,例如时间特征、交互特征(如A*B)或多项式特征(如A²)。

3. 特征选择

  • 过滤方法:基于统计指标(如卡方检验、互信息)筛选特征。
  • 包裹方法:通过模型性能评估特征的重要性,例如使用LASSO回归或随机森林。
  • 嵌入方法:在模型训练过程中学习特征的重要性,例如使用神经网络或XGBoost。

4. 特征变换

  • 分箱:将连续特征离散化,例如将年龄分为“0-18岁”、“19-30岁”等。
  • 对数变换:对于偏态分布的特征,可以通过对数变换降低数据的偏斜程度。

二、模型调优的核心方法

模型调优是通过优化模型参数和结构,提升模型性能的过程。以下是几种常见的模型调优方法:

1. 超参数调优

  • 网格搜索(Grid Search):遍历所有可能的参数组合,找到最优参数。
  • 随机搜索(Random Search):随机采样参数组合,适用于参数空间较大的情况。
  • 贝叶斯优化:基于概率模型,逐步缩小参数范围,提升优化效率。

2. 集成学习

  • 投票法:将多个模型的预测结果进行投票,例如随机森林。
  • 堆叠法:将多个模型的输出作为新特征,输入到另一个模型中进行预测。
  • 袋装法(Bagging):通过 bootstrap 重采样生成多个基模型,降低模型的方差。

3. 模型解释性

  • 特征重要性分析:通过模型(如随机森林、XGBoost)输出特征重要性,了解哪些特征对结果影响最大。
  • SHAP值:使用SHAP(Shapley Additive exPlanations)解释模型的预测结果,揭示每个特征对单个预测的贡献。

三、特征工程与模型调优的结合

特征工程和模型调优是相辅相成的。通过特征工程,我们可以为模型提供更高质量的输入;通过模型调优,我们可以进一步提升模型的性能。以下是两者结合的几个关键点:

1. 迭代优化

  • 在特征工程阶段,可以通过模型的反馈(如特征重要性)不断优化特征。
  • 在模型调优阶段,可以根据特征工程的结果调整模型参数,例如减少对低重要性特征的依赖。

2. 交叉验证

  • 使用交叉验证(如K折交叉验证)评估模型的泛化能力,确保模型在不同数据集上的表现一致。

3. 模型融合

  • 将多个模型的预测结果进行融合,例如使用加权平均或投票法,提升模型的鲁棒性。

四、未来趋势与建议

随着数据中台、数字孪生和数字可视化技术的不断发展,数据分析的场景和需求也在不断变化。以下是几点未来趋势与建议:

1. 自动化特征工程

  • 随着机器学习技术的进步,自动化特征工程工具(如AutoML)将越来越普及,帮助企业用户更高效地完成特征提取和构造。

2. 解释性模型的崛起

  • 在业务决策中,模型的解释性越来越重要。未来,基于解释性模型(如线性回归、SHAP)的应用将更加广泛。

3. 实时数据分析

  • 随着数字孪生和实时数据流的普及,实时数据分析的需求将不断增加。企业需要构建高效的实时数据分析 pipeline。

五、总结与广告

通过高效的特征工程和模型调优,企业可以显著提升数据分析的效果,为业务决策提供更有力的支持。无论是数据中台的构建、数字孪生的应用,还是数字可视化的实现,这些技术都将为企业带来更大的价值。

如果您对数据分析感兴趣,或者希望进一步了解相关技术,欢迎申请试用我们的产品:申请试用。我们的平台为您提供高效、易用的数据分析工具,助力您的业务成功。


希望本文能够为您提供实用的见解和启发,帮助您在数据分析的实践中取得更好的效果!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料